MBA Online has visualized the data provided to AdAge by Magid Generational Strategies. The resulting infographic breaks down media consumption during different time periods and into five generations: Baby Boomers (47-65), Generation X (30-46), Adult Millennials (18-29), Teen Millennials (13-17), and iGen(12 and under).
